After a successful season for Arizona football, head coach Brent Brennan said it's "absolutely critical" to maintain the continuity of the Wildcats' coaching staff.
Brennan said it's imperative for the Wildcats to keep their coaching staff intact, especially defensive coordinator Danny Gonzales and offensive coordinator Seth Doege, who are both in their first season as coordinators at Arizona.Β

"I think leadership is so important," Brennan said. "It's obvious that the world of college football thinks it's important, too, when you look at what has happened over the last two or three weeks. Keeping our staff together is the most important thing I can do right now. That's what we're working really hard at."
Gonzales is one of 15 coaches up for theΒ Broyles Award, which is given to the top assistant coach in college football.Β Β
In Gonzales' first season as Arizona's defensive coordinator, the Wildcats rank in the Top 20 nationally in several defensive categories, including pass defense (fourth), interceptions (fourth) and scoring defense (19th). The Wildcats have held eight straight opponents to fewer than 200 passing yards, which is tied for the longest streak in the Big 12 since Missouri in 2004.Β

Arizona's 28 takeaways this season lead the nation. It's the most takeaways by an Arizona team since 2000.Β Arizona has more takeaways (28) than touchdowns allowed (25).Β
Three Wildcats are tied for the second-most interceptions in the Big 12: defensive backs Dalton Johnson, Treydan Stukes and Jay'Vion Cole. Johnson's 97 tackles are the most by a defensive back in the Big 12.
Stukes and Johnson were both named All-Big 12 first-team selections. This year is the first time that Arizona has produced multiple first-team all-conference defensive backs since All-WAC selections Jackie Wallace and Bob White in 1972.Β
Under Doege, Arizona's offense went from averaging 21.8 points (15th in the Big 12) and 354.5 yards of total offense per game (14th in the Big 12) last season to averaging 32.6 points (third in the Big 12) and 404.8 yards of total offense (sixth in the Big 12) per game.

Arizona star quarterback Noah Fifita, who received votes for Big 12 Offensive Player of the Year, was named a first-team All-Big 12 quarterback. Fifita became the third all-time Arizona quarterback to earn all-conference first-team honors β the first in 50 years.
Fifita joined Bruce Hill, who was an All-WAC first-team selection in 1975, and Ted Bland, a three-time All-Border Conference selection from 1933-35.Β
Fifita passed for a career-high 2,963 yards, 26 touchdowns and five interceptions in the regular season β a season after tossing 12 interceptions. Fifita's 26 passing touchdowns are a career-high and the fifth-most in a season by a UA quarterback. Fifita needs three more passing touchdowns to set Arizona's single-season touchdown record. He currently owns Arizona's record for the most career passing touchdowns (70), which he set in Arizona's upset win over No. 25 Cincinnati last month.Β
"We're making really good progress of getting Coach Doege and Coach Gonzales here for a long time and I'm excited about that," Brennan said. "They're tremendous coaches, tremendous human beings and we're making progress there."
Gonzales'Β salary will rise from $600,000 to $900,000Β for the 2026 season, which will make him the highest-paid assistant coach in UA history. Doege currently earns $750,000 and is contracted through 2027, according toΒ a list of salaries obtained by the Star in August.Β
Keeping both coordinators long-term is a priority for Brennan this month.Β
"The consistency of messaging, the consistency of process, the consistency of leadership is so important in building high-level organizations β and a football program is no different," Brennan said. "That's one of those things that's critical for us here. ... Consistency matters and (the UA administration has) been so important the last couple of weeks in putting stuff together.
"I like the way we're going right now and I'm optimistic about the future."Β
